"""Config flow for Ecovacs mqtt integration."""
from __future__ import annotations
import logging
from typing import Any, cast
from aiohttp import ClientError
from deebot_client.authentication import Authenticator
from deebot_client.exceptions import InvalidAuthenticationError
from deebot_client.models import Configuration
from deebot_client.util import md5
from deebot_client.util.continents import COUNTRIES_TO_CONTINENTS, get_continent
import voluptuous as vol
from homeassistant.config_entries import ConfigFlow
from homeassistant.const import CONF_COUNTRY, CONF_PASSWORD, CONF_USERNAME
from homeassistant.core import DOMAIN as HOMEASSISTANT_DOMAIN, HomeAssistant
from homeassistant.data_entry_flow import AbortFlow, FlowResult
from homeassistant.helpers import aiohttp_client, selector
from homeassistant.helpers.issue_registry import IssueSeverity, async_create_issue
from homeassistant.loader import async_get_issue_tracker
from .const import CONF_CONTINENT, DOMAIN
from .util import get_client_device_id
_LOGGER = logging.getLogger(__name__)
async def _validate_input(
hass: HomeAssistant, user_input: dict[str, Any]
) -> dict[str, str]:
"""Validate user input."""
errors: dict[str, str] = {}
deebot_config = Configuration(
aiohttp_client.async_get_clientsession(hass),
device_id=get_client_device_id(),
country=user_input[CONF_COUNTRY],
continent=user_input.get(CONF_CONTINENT),
)
authenticator = Authenticator(
deebot_config,
user_input[CONF_USERNAME],
md5(user_input[CONF_PASSWORD]),
)
try:
await authenticator.authenticate()
except ClientError:
_LOGGER.debug("Cannot connect", exc_info=True)
errors["base"] = "cannot_connect"
except InvalidAuthenticationError:
errors["base"] = "invalid_auth"
except Exception: # pylint: disable=broad-except
_LOGGER.exception("Unexpected exception during login")
errors["base"] = "unknown"
return errors
class EcovacsConfigFlow(ConfigFlow, domain=DOMAIN):
"""Handle a config flow for Ecovacs."""
VERSION = 1
async def async_step_user(
self, user_input: dict[str, Any] | None = None
) -> FlowResult:
"""Handle the initial step."""
errors = {}
if user_input:
self._async_abort_entries_match({CONF_USERNAME: user_input[CONF_USERNAME]})
errors = await _validate_input(self.hass, user_input)
if not errors:
return self.async_create_entry(
title=user_input[CONF_USERNAME], data=user_input
)
return self.async_show_form(
step_id="user",
data_schema=self.add_suggested_values_to_schema(
data_schema=vol.Schema(
{
vol.Required(CONF_USERNAME): selector.TextSelector(
selector.TextSelectorConfig(
type=selector.TextSelectorType.TEXT
)
),
vol.Required(CONF_PASSWORD): selector.TextSelector(
selector.TextSelectorConfig(
type=selector.TextSelectorType.PASSWORD
)
),
vol.Required(CONF_COUNTRY): selector.CountrySelector(),
}
),
suggested_values=user_input
or {
CONF_COUNTRY: self.hass.config.country,
},
),
errors=errors,
)
async def async_step_import(self, user_input: dict[str, Any]) -> FlowResult:
"""Import configuration from yaml."""
def create_repair(
error: str | None = None, placeholders: dict[str, Any] | None = None
) -> None:
if placeholders is None:
placeholders = {}
if error:
async_create_issue(
self.hass,
DOMAIN,
f"deprecated_yaml_import_issue_{error}",
breaks_in_ha_version="2024.8.0",
is_fixable=False,
issue_domain=DOMAIN,
severity=IssueSeverity.WARNING,
translation_key=f"deprecated_yaml_import_issue_{error}",
translation_placeholders=placeholders
| {"url": "/config/integrations/dashboard/add?domain=ecovacs"},
)
else:
async_create_issue(
self.hass,
HOMEASSISTANT_DOMAIN,
f"deprecated_yaml_{DOMAIN}",
breaks_in_ha_version="2024.8.0",
is_fixable=False,
issue_domain=DOMAIN,
severity=IssueSeverity.WARNING,
translation_key="deprecated_yaml",
translation_placeholders=placeholders
| {
"domain": DOMAIN,
"integration_title": "Ecovacs",
},
)
# We need to validate the imported country and continent
# as the YAML configuration allows any string for them.
# The config flow allows only valid alpha-2 country codes
# through the CountrySelector.
# The continent will be calculated with the function get_continent
# from the country code and there is no need to specify the continent anymore.
# As the YAML configuration includes the continent,
# we check if both the entered continent and the calculated continent match.
# If not we will inform the user about the mismatch.
error = None
placeholders = None
if len(user_input[CONF_COUNTRY]) != 2:
error = "invalid_country_length"
placeholders = {"countries_url": "https://www.iso.org/obp/ui/#search/code/"}
elif len(user_input[CONF_CONTINENT]) != 2:
error = "invalid_continent_length"
placeholders = {
"continent_list": ",".join(
sorted(set(COUNTRIES_TO_CONTINENTS.values()))
)
}
elif user_input[CONF_CONTINENT].lower() != (
continent := get_continent(user_input[CONF_COUNTRY])
):
error = "continent_not_match"
placeholders = {
"continent": continent,
"github_issue_url": cast(
str, async_get_issue_tracker(self.hass, integration_domain=DOMAIN)
),
}
if error:
create_repair(error, placeholders)
return self.async_abort(reason=error)
# Remove the continent from the user input as it is not needed anymore
user_input.pop(CONF_CONTINENT)
try:
result = await self.async_step_user(user_input)
except AbortFlow as ex:
if ex.reason == "already_configured":
create_repair()
raise ex
if errors := result.get("errors"):
error = errors["base"]
create_repair(error)
return self.async_abort(reason=error)
create_repair()
return result
